Desktop Client Devices
Notice Description
Scottish Ministers are seeking to appoint a single supplier for a national collaborative arrangement for Desktop Client Devices.
Lot Information
Lot 1
Scottish Procurement have a requirement for the provision of Desktop Client Devices, accessories and associated deployment services to the Scottish Public Sector. The framework is to provide of the following: Desktop Devices, Monitors and Fixed Workstation Devices along with accessories and associated deployment services.
Renewal: The initial duration of the framework agreement will be 24 months with the option to extend for a further 24 months.
